Bringing out the latest thinking on the use of technology in education, this timely seminar followed the publication of the report by the Education Technology Action Group (ETAG), created to promote the use of technology across schools, colleges and universities.
Sessions focused on examples of current best practice, and latest thinking on the potential for expanding and improving the use of technology in teaching, learning and assessment. Delegates also discussed how latest learning technologies such as flipped learning, MOOCs for schools and 3D printing can be used to complement and transform teaching methods.
Further areas in the agenda included teacher training and professional development; the potential for technology to enhance pupil assessment and progress monitoring; promoting personalised learning; improving access to technology; and provision for pupils with special educational needs.
